397329-91-8

397329-91-8 structure
397329-91-8 structure

Name (R)-2-((4-(4-bromobenzyl)-1-(3,5-dichlorophenyl)-4-methyl-5-oxo-4,5-dihydro-1H-imidazol-2-yl)amino)acetic acid
Molecular Formula C19H16BrCl2N3O3
Molecular Weight 485.15900
Exact Mass 482.97500
PSA 82.00000
LogP 4.02560
Precursor  0

DownStream  2